Released in September of 1982, 'Heartbreaker' sung by Dionne Warwick entered the Australian chart on December 6, and would rise to #2 in 1983; spending 21 weeks in the chart and becoming the 18th best seller of the year. After Barbra Streisand benefited so majorly from Barry Gibb and his brothers on her 1980 opus 'Guilty', every big name was clamouring for a piece of the Gibb brothers' magic and Dionne's album and single 'Heartbreaker' was certainly that. I recall at the time Casey Kasem telling his listeners on the weekly AT 40 broadcast I religiously tuned in for, that Dionne was the then oldest artist to make the Top 10 - at the terribly old age of 42!!!! It was certainly testament to the enduring popularity of this iconic vocalist but also the genius of the Bee Gees to write and produce golden hits.
'Heartbreaker' was a #2 in England as well here in Oz, but only peaked at #10 in America, but went on to sell some 4 million copies worldwide and is considered one of Dionne's best sellers in a career filled with big hits. Ms Warwick's career had hit a slump in the 1970's other than a duet with The Spinners: 'Then Came You', but then came Barry Manilow with 1979's 'Dionne' and the pair of Grammy wins for her on 'I'll Never Love This Way Again' & 'Deja Vu'. Her Arista record label tenure was a most fruitful one, and Dionne would continue to create one album after another which satisfied the fan base that adored her combination of Pop/R&B and Adult Contemporary recordings such as Heartbreaker which afforded her with her 8th #1 on the AC chart. Purportedly, Dionne was never especially enamored with 'Heartbreaker' but trusted Barry Gibb and her Producers to craft the song. She had admitted earlier in her career that she was not fond of 'Do You Know The Way To San Jose' as well, and that ended up being one of her greatest, and it is common knowledge that the great vocalist made some questionable decision in some other ventures, so thankfully her music career was well looked after!
